In March 2023, Mia was awarded the 1st Nancy Swanson Services Award from the Illinois Association for Music Therapy for her focused provider into the profession. She has also Earlier served around the regional conference planning committees and is a Regular presenter at conferences and at bordering Midwest universities on topics together with music therapy with older adults, dementia, Parkinson’s disease, and in hospice care, harmonica protocols, and getting a fresh professional.
Mia began her career to be a workers member inside of a memory care community and helped a neighborhood hospice set up a music therapy program. Later in 2017, Mia began working in a nationwide hospice and palliative care organization, from the Southwest Chicago suburbs. There, she crafted a very powerful music therapy program and was awarded their national Very best award in 2019 and 2020 for Creating Excellence, Pleasure, and Teamwork.

In other studies, Klassen and colleagues (2008) checked out 19 randomized managed trials and found that music therapy considerably reduced anxiety and pain in children undergoing medical and dental procedures.

The music therapist asks Richard about his favorite song and Richard names a song from his younger adulthood. The music therapist performs the song on his guitar for Richard and Richard appears reflective. The song brought up a selected memory that Richard shares with the music therapist.
